Three Agricultural Development Cooperatives Established under LWD Support

Kampong Chhnang (23-Jun-2011) – Three Agricultural Development Cooperatives (ADC) in three communes, Teuk Phos district of Kampong Chhnang province received licenses from the Ministry of Agriculture, Fishery, and Forestry today, after each ADC’s structure complied with the ADC Royal Decree.

AC_KC_001The Cooperatives, named “Khbal Teuk Chhean Leung (KCADC)”, ”Peam Mean Chey (PMCADC)”, and “Ponleu Samaki (PACO)” , were set up after an over 7 months-long preparation under the support of Life With Dignity (LWD) in close collaboration with the Department of Agriculture in Kampong Chhnang.

LWD Executive Director, Dr Sam Inn said in his speech that this establishment was the joint efforts of LWD and the Department of Agriculture in Kampong Chhnang. “ADC plays very important role to make economic growth by linking our rural communities to the markets” he said.

“LWD will continue to strengthen and support these cooperatives and help address challenges when the cooperatives faces and to ensure their functioning,” he said, adding that LWD supported the establishment of 6 ADCs, including 3 from last year in Kampong Chhnang and it planned 2 more in the future.

In his speech, His Excellency Chan Sarun, Minister of Ministry of Agriculture, Forestry and Fishery (MAFF), strongly appreciated the support of LWD to set up these ADCs.

He said the ADCs would help their members in their farming business. “To ensure the sustainability and good-functioning of the ACDs, capacity building and other leadership skills will be needed to provide to their leaders and members,” he said.

These ADCs currently made up of 509 members (305 Females) from 3 communes with total capital of 10,370,000 Riels, accrued from selling shares to members. Today, each ADC received a capital of 8,000,000 Riels from LWD.

To become a member of each ADC, each farmer is required to pay membership fee of 3,000 riels (US$0.75) and buy at least a share worth 10,000 riels (US$2.50), according to their by-law and ADC Royal Decree. Each member can own a maximum of 100 shares.
